This novel follows Helen Graham, a mysterious woman who arrives at Wildfell Hall. Rumours label her a "wicked woman" but she is revealed to be the estranged wife of an abusive alcoholic. Helen seeks to protect her son from the toxic environment created by her husband. Through her story, the novel explores themes of marital cruelty, the societal position of women, and the quest for redemption. Anne Brontë draws from her own experiences to depict the harsh realities faced by women in her time.
